Task Force on National Infrastructure Pipeline
- On 29th April, 2020, the Task Force on National Infrastructure Pipeline (NIP), headed by the economic affairs secretary Atanu Chakraborty submitted its Final Report on NIP for FY 2019-25 to the government.
- The Summary Report of the Task Force on National Infrastructure Pipeline for 2019-2025 has already been released by the Finance Minister on December 31st, 2019.
- The task force was set up following Prime Minister Narendra Modi Independence Day speech of 2019 where he alluded to an investment of Rs 100 lakh crore in infrastructure.
